Поделиться через


ApplicationIdentity(String) Конструктор

Определение

Инициализирует новый экземпляр класса ApplicationIdentity.

public:
 ApplicationIdentity(System::String ^ applicationIdentityFullName);
public ApplicationIdentity (string applicationIdentityFullName);
new ApplicationIdentity : string -> ApplicationIdentity
Public Sub New (applicationIdentityFullName As String)

Параметры

applicationIdentityFullName
String

Полное имя приложения.

Исключения

applicationIdentityFullName имеет значение null.

Комментарии

Формат applicationIdentityFullName параметра представляет собой строку Юникода с разделителями-запятыми, которая начинается с имени следующим образом:

applicationURL  
#  
deploymentIdentity  
\  
applicationIdentity  

Где deploymentIdentity =

deploymentManifest  
, Version =   
Major.Minor.Build.Revision  
, Culture =   
CultureInfo  
, PublicKeyToken=  
TokenNumber  
, processorArchitecture=  
processorArchitecture  

И applicationIdentity =

applicationName  
, Version =   
Major.Minor.Build.Revision  
, Culture =   
CultureInfo  
, PublicKeyToken=  
TokenNumber  
, processorArchitecture=  
processorArchitecture  
, type=  
OsType  

Ниже приведен пример полного имени приложения с именем ActivationContext.

http://testserver/ActivationContext/ActivationContext.application  
#ActivationContext.application, Version=1.0.0.0, Culture=neutral, PublicKeyToken=ae13aad84c1a3490, processorArchitecture=msil  
\ActivationContext.exe, Version=1.0.0.0, Culture=neutral, PublicKeyToken=ae13aad84c1a3490, processorArchitecture=msil, type=win32  

Значение по умолчанию для архитектуры процессора — msil, а для типа — win32.

Применяется к